Gas Furnace Installation in Kansas City, MO
Gas furnace install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ing heating systems with new, efficient gas-powered furnaces. These projects typically include installing a complete heating unit, connecting it to existing ductwork, and ensuring proper ventilation and safety measures. Homeowners often request this service when replacing an outdated or malfunctioning furnace, upgrading for better energy efficiency, or installing a heating system in a new property. It’s important for property owners to understand the different furnace models available, the compatibility with their current home setup, and any necessary permits or inspections required for the installation.
Before requesting gas furnace installation, property owners should consider the size and heating needs of their home to select an appropriately rated unit. They may also want to inquire about the installation process, including any modifications needed to existing ductwork or ventilation systems. Understanding the warranty options and maintenance requirements can help ensure the new furnace operates reliably and efficiently over time. Proper planning and information can contribute to a smooth installation process and long-term comfort.

Gas Furnace Installation Questions
What are the benefits of installing a gas furnace? Installing a gas furnace can provide reliable heating during colder months and improve overall home comfort with efficient temperature control.
How do I know if a gas furnace is suitable for my property? Factors like home size, existing ductwork, and fuel availability influence whether a gas furnace is appropriate for a property.
What should homeowners consider before installing a gas furnace? Homeowners should consider the size of the unit, energy efficiency ratings, and compatibility with current heating systems.
What types of gas furnaces are commonly installed? Common options include single-stage, two-stage, and modulating gas furnaces, each offering different levels of efficiency and performance.
